The advanced ceramic and semiconductor material Silicon Carbide is distinguished by its exceptional combination of hardness, thermal conductivity, chemical resistance and wide-bandgap electronic properties, which make it suitable for a broad range of high-performance applications. These characteristics underpin its deployment in demanding environments such as metal-casting crucibles, furnace linings, abrasive tools, armor systems, high-temperature gas turbines and high-voltage power electronics.

In the manufacturing realm, silicon carbide powders are used as abrasive grains in grinding, honing, sand-blasting and cutting tools—its hardness (close to 9.5 on the Mohs scale) and stability under high temperatures allow it to outperform many traditional materials used in wear-resistant applications. For example, in foundries it serves as crucible liners that endure molten metal, while in mechanical systems it appears in bearings, seals and components exposed to sliding contact and high temperatures or corrosive media. The material’s thermal shock resistance and oxidation stability further enhance its life in applications whenever rapid changes in temperature occur or when exposure to molten salts, alkalis or acidic environments is significant. As a high-performance carbide material, silicon carbide exhibits a crystalline structure of silicon and carbon atoms arranged in repeating polytypes, delivering high melting points (around 2,700 °C), extremely high thermal conductivity, low coefficient of thermal expansion and excellent wear and corrosion resistance.

In the electronics and power semiconductor sector, silicon carbide is gaining increasing prominence because its wide bandgap enables higher breakdown voltages, higher temperature operation, higher switching frequencies and greater thermal efficiency compared with standard silicon-based semiconductors. This makes it ideal for high-power, high-frequency and high-temperature devices such as Schottky diodes, MOSFETs and IGBTs used in electric vehicles, renewable energy inverters, industrial motor drives and aerospace power systems. Thanks to its excellent heat dissipation and stability, SiC-based systems deliver superior performance, lower losses and smaller cooling requirements.

Beyond abrasives and electronics, silicon carbide is used in thermal management materials, flame-retardant composites, armor-grade ceramics, and high-temperature structural components for aerospace and energy generation. Its resistance to chemical attack enables its use in chemical processing equipment, gas turbines and other environments where corrosion and erosion are critical concerns.
